Gateway to the moors and the coast, discover the delights of northern Cornwall from a Launceston cottage, situated in and around this ancient Cornish capital on the Devon/Cornwall border.

Lose yourself amid the narrow streets of this delightful market town, steeped in history and dominated by an imposing Norman castle. Delve into stylish galleries and appealing shops selling exclusive gifts and mouth-watering produce. An indoor weekly market and monthly open-air Butter Market ensure your Launceston cottage's fridge will always stay stocked!

Attractions close to your Launceston cottage

Follow the town trail and find St. Mary's Church with its elaborate carvings and Launceston House Museum, a fine Georgian building. For a bird's-eye view of the town's intricate layout, not to mention sweeping views towards Dartmoor and Bodmin, climb up to Launceston's ancient keep. Two long distance walking trails also start here: the Two Castles Trail linking Launceston with Okehampton and the Tamar Valley Discovery Trail.

Step aboard the Victorian carriages of the Launceston Steam Railway, which chugs along the Kensey Valley to and from the hamlet of New Mills, home to a small farm park. You'll also find a couple of other family parks a short drive from town, as well as the Tamar Otter & Wildlife Centre - a must for lovers of the cute and furry!

Also look out for rural shows and other countryside events like the Steam and Vintage Rally. Or get out and about in the Tamar Valley, a designated AONB.

At the end of the day, enjoy a meal out in one of Launceston's restaurants or simply unwind in your cosy Launceston cottage.
